The idea behind most roleplay usually termed "nation roleplay" or "NRP" is not to overtake or dominate a large-scale roleplay, but to enrich and provide sociological, economic, and political background to such a setting. "Nation roleplay," or roleplaying that involves nation states, de facto state entities, or state-like factions, is intended to be a breeding ground for character development, provide a backdrop for character interactions, and create multiple avenues for diverse and engaging plotlines to develop at both micro and macro levels.

In my own writing, I focus predominantly on the development of individual characters and the dynamics of interactions among those characters. I find overarching, meta-plotlines like this invasion plotline to be an excellent impetus for engendering and fostering more vibrant and compelling character interactions and new plot ideas by creating multiple sources of tension. Characters need not have any high rank or formal affiliation with a faction in order to be impacted by larger events (think of what happens to average citizens when any country goes to war), nor will they necessarily be directly affected in any significant way (think about the everyday lives of most Americans during the Iraq war.) But you, the writers and roleplayers, will have a myriad of opportunities to create, develop, and form deeper and more interesting plots to feature your character(s), given a new set of macro-circumstances.

Um. Okay. Bear with me. I read through what posts I saw, and took note on things that were said to the best of my ability. Here's where I stand on the Multiverse, where the Multiverse is to me, and yeah. I guess.

I agree that there needs to be a set baseline. For instance, the name of the bar. The name of the world that the bar is on. The name of cities, nearby things like that. There can be a set system of government, the Wing City Police Department, but their "jurisdiction" only stretches so far. Some of the most interesting roleplay I've seen/participated in has involved characters coming from other worlds and having to either deal with, work around, or confront the system of government set in the Multiverse.

Alternately, some of the worst and most frustrating MV roleplaying I've seen has been .. involving characters coming from other worlds and having to deal with, work around, or confront the system of government set in the Multiverse.

I've always seen the MV as a hallways connecting various rooms. The rooms are your own story, your own ideas, your own canon, your own characters; it's where your friends gather and you control things. When you're out in that hall, however, all bets are off. That isn't to say you can pull things out of your ass, but you accept and understand a certain amount of handicap.

For instance, my character Liesha Kennicot is a Special Agent in the United States government, from her Earth. She's aware that there are other Earths, and that she doesn't had any control when in the MV. That's fine. However, when someone else walks up to her and starts trying to give her orders claiming that their faction has taken over mine without a single bit of IC content, that's when things start to go awry.

Reading back over the original post, it seems that the Multiverse has as much substance as you give it. It's a sandbox location where you can freely interact with new characters that you might not get a chance to. For a while, I used the MV as a way to try and test out ideas with people before making a roleplay out of it. You get your circles of friends (as Patch mentioned, his crew of eight) and you go at it. Sometimes you meet in the middle, and sometimes you don't.

And at the risk of ranting, that is all I have to say about that.
